Supplementary treatment might be necessary for the good thing about the populace. A person these occasion could be the fluoridation of water, the place fluoride is extra to water. It's been said by the earth Wellness Business that ‘fluoridation of water supplies, where by feasible, is the best general public wellness measure for that avoidance of dental decay. The ideal fluoride level is around one mg per liter of water (one mg l–one).
